Gov Abdulrazaq Congratulates Nigerians on 64th Independence Anniversary

Date: 2024-10-01

Kwara State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q felicitates President Bola Tinubu and the people of Nigeria on the 64th anniversary of the country.

Governor AbdulRazaq specifically congratulates the people of Kwara State on the milestone. “I am upbeat that this country is destined for greatness. Together, we can achieve not just the dream of our fathers for Nigeria but surpass it as everyone plays their roles in their own corners,” he says in a statement.

“But we need to know that nation building is a marathon and an endeavour that requires collective efforts to achieve. I commend the President for his bold reforms and the palliatives to temper its initial fallouts on the people, including the huge efforts to boost food security and critical national infrastructure. This is being complemented at subnational levels with improved infrastructural development, investments in human capital development, and different economic initiatives and social protection measures designed to improve the living conditions of the people.

“I join Mr. President and other patriots to appeal for patience and support as we navigate this phase. The fruits will be sweeter for all. Happy Independence Anniversary, dear compatriots!”
